**Runbook 4.2 — Account Recovery, Parcelwing Webhook.** If the Parcelwing parcel-tracking webhook loses its service account (usually after a failed credential rotation), first suspend inbound carrier events to avoid duplicate deliveries. Then re-provision the account from the Dovecrest vault console. Note for the weekly eng sync: the vault console will prompt for the recovery passphrase, which is recorded below.

recovery phrase for yawig-kajog: casox-prair-holax-quenix-fraael-belath-casath

Subject: Meralux Line Pricing — What's Changing

Team, quick update for you to pass to branch managers: we're raising Meralux Classic prices by roughly six percent in the new catalogue, while the Meralux Lite tier stays put to keep the entry point competitive. Existing quotes honoured for thirty days. Expect some pushback from long-standing accounts — loyalty credits are available, details coming from Finance. The thinking behind the move is summarised in the confidential note below.

internal memo for hahif-hahaf: Headcount on the Zorwyn team goes from 9 to 100 by the end of October. Gross margin on Zorwyn came in at 5 percent against a plan of 10 percent.

Leadership Review Briefing — Sales Leads
Subject: Corvalta Pro tier.
Launch set for Q2. Price point tested in the Ellsmere pilot: 12% conversion from standard accounts. Feature set locked — priority routing, audit exports, dedicated onboarding. Quotas will be adjusted once the Marrow Lane team finalises territory splits. No discounting without director approval. Questions to Priya Venholt. The confidential business plan note follows directly below.

internal memo for bahap-yagug: Headcount on the Ulaix team goes from 3 to 100 by the end of January. Gross margin on Ulaix came in at 10 percent against a plan of 15 percent.

**Q: Why does the ChalkGrid solver say "infeasible" on valid timetables?**

Usually a hidden constraint conflict: a teacher double-booked via an imported roster, or room capacity set to zero after a sync. ChalkGrid reports infeasibility without naming the culprit in the current version. First steps: re-run with diagnostics enabled, check the constraint summary, and look for rooms with null capacity. Escalate only if diagnostics come back clean. The full triage flowchart for support is maintained here.

operations page: https://jenkins.zemvarcloud.local/job/merge_requests/repo/build/73930b4b30f0a8ed